Nissan has teamed up with German camper builder Eifelland to turn the electric Interstar-e van into a home on wheels. From the outside, it looks like a regular Nissan van, but inside it's so much more. It's called the Nissan Interstar-e Relax, and it looks like it'll let its passengers do just that. The Relax's 87 kWh battery is enough to give it 408 miles of WLTP-rated range, which is probably enough for most camper van folks. With a single electric motor, the Nissan camper only makes 143 horsepower and 221 lb-ft of torque.
